Boundary Stone At Harwood Carrs On East Side Of Fence is a Grade II listed building in the Northumberland local planning authority area, England. First listed on 18 June 1986. Boundary stone.

Description

HEXHAMSHIRE HEXHAMSHIRE COMMON NY 85 SE NY 87605036

13/178 Boundary stone at Harwood Carrs on east side of fence

II

Boundary stone, probably C18. Sandstone, 0.65 metre high with segmental bead. Incised B on west and C on east.

Listing NGR: NY8760050348
